Kevin Hart, American stand-up comedian, producer, and actor has been sued by his sex tape partner, Montia Sabbag for 60 million dollars.

Sabbag claimed that he secretly recorded their intimate encounter in 2017 at Las Vega hotel, while explaining that her affair with Hart was planned by himself and his friend, Jackson who was arrested for extortion, according to TMZ reports.

She stated that the reason why Hart and his friend hid the camera at the time was for publicity, especially with an upcoming comedy tour.

Earlier, on September 2017, the footage was being shopped around of Hart allegedly engaging in sexual intercourse with Sabagg in a Las Vegas hotel room.

However, his friend, Jonathan Jackson, was later arrested after he allegedly tried selling the footage and Hart claimed he was the victim of ‘extortion’.

Jackson, who denied ever extorting the comedian, was later charged with a two-count charge of extortion relating to alleged efforts to get money out of Hart to keep the tape under wraps.

However, Sabagg claims that Hart was also involved in the act.

According to the suit she filed, Hart allowed Jackson into the Cosmopolitan Hotel suite so he could set up hidden video recording devices to capture the liaison.

Meanwhile, the comedian and actor who was recently involved in a fatal motor accident has been reportedly moved to a physical therapy facility where he would be undergoing further treatment.
